President Donald Trump plans to maximize oil and gas production and had declared a national energy emergency last week to accelerate permitting of oil, gas and power projects, roll back environmental protections and withdraw the U.S. from the climate pact. The oil and natural gas producer, backed by buyout firms Pearl Energy Investments and NGP, sold 13.25 million shares within the marketed range of $18 and $21 apiece to raise $265 million.
